Why was Juan de Fuca important?

Juan de Fuca was a Greek sailor who conducted exploration voyages for Spain in the 16th century. He explored the western coast of northwestern North America.

Why is underwater exploration important?

Underwater exploration is important because it helps us better understand our oceans and marine life, discover new species, study underwater ecosystems, and uncover historical shipwrecks. This knowledge is crucial for conservation efforts, resource management, and advancing our understanding of Earth's biodiversity.

Why was the Northwest Passage important for Lewis and Clark?

It wasn't. Lewis and Clark had nothing to do with the exploration of the Northwest Passage. The purpose of the Lewis and Clark expedition was to explore the newly acquired Louisiana Purchase and points west.

What river is most important to Louisiana history?

The Mississippi River is the most important river in Louisiana's history. It has served as a vital artery for trade and transportation since the early days of European exploration and settlement. The river's delta region is crucial for agriculture, particularly for the cultivation of sugarcane and cotton, shaping the state's economy. Additionally, the Mississippi River played a significant role in the cultural and social development of Louisiana, influencing everything from cuisine to music.
